Plantar fasciitis – does it reoccur following surgery?
I saw a fellow this morning for heel pain. Clinical and x-ray finding were consistent with plantar fasciitis, right heel. But there was a problem with that diagnosis. The problem was that we had performed an endoscopic plantar fasciotomy on the same foot 5 years ago. Had the plantar fasciitis returned? It sure did seem that way.
Plantar fasciotomy, regardless of the method used (open with medial approach, open plantar approach, endoscopic, etc) is a reliable, time tested method of caring for recalcitrant cases of plantar fasciitis. But can plantar fasciitis recur following surgery? And after a 5 years period of being pain free? It appears the answer is yes.
The scientist in me knows that things happen for a reason. So what would be the reason that plantar fasciitis would reoccur? I’d have to guess that the patient had changed. Think of it this way, when you treat plantar fasciitis with a surgical procedure, you’re treating a patient who weighs a certain amount, has a certain level of activity and has a certain tissue elasticity specific to their age. That can change. And in this case, I think that change in this specific patient is at the heart of why the plantar fasciitis recurred.
What can change and what are the dynamics that could contribute to the return of plantar fasciitis post surgery? Body weight, age and tissue elasticity are important factors. And an increase in the duration of time on the feet could also be a significant variable. Plantar fasciitis doesn’t reoccur without a reason. It comes back for a specific reason. And I’d assume that it’s a combination of one or more of the above.
I’m not aware of any articles in the literature regarding the return of plantar fasciitis following surgery. So quoting return rates would be just a guess. But for those considering a plantar fasciotomy, the procedure can still be a very good choice to treat heel pain.Â
